当前位置: 首页 > news >正文

asp.net mvc 向前端响应json数据。用到jquery

   最近在给客户开发提醒软件时,用asp.net mvc 开发。该框架已经集成了bootstrap,直接贴asp.net  mvc 端代码:


@{
    Layout = null;
}

<!DOCTYPE html>

<html>
<head>
    <meta name="viewport" content="width=device-width" />
    <title>getArrTest</title>
    <script src="~/Scripts/jquery-3.7.0.min.js"></script>
    <script src="~/Scripts/jquery.unobtrusive-ajax.js"></script>
    <script type="text/javascript">
/*定义方法,从后端获取供应商数据*/
    function GetSuppliers() {
        /*首先清空select数据*/
        $("#supplier").empty()
        $.ajax({
            url: "/Test/SendJson",
            type: "post",
            success: function (getdata) {
                console.log(getdata)
                //console.log(getdata[0])
            }
          
        })
    };
    </script>
</head>
<body>
    <div> 
       <button onclick="GetSuppliers()">获取数组数据</button>
    </div>
</body>
</html>

html端通过jquery获取数据:


@{
    Layout = null;
}

<!DOCTYPE html>

<html>
<head>
    <meta name="viewport" content="width=device-width" />
    <title>getArrTest</title>
    <script src="~/Scripts/jquery-3.7.0.min.js"></script>
    <script src="~/Scripts/jquery.unobtrusive-ajax.js"></script>
    <script type="text/javascript">
/*定义方法,从后端获取供应商数据*/
    function GetSuppliers() {
        /*首先清空select数据*/
        $("#supplier").empty()
        $.ajax({
            url: "/Test/SendJson",
            type: "post",
            success: function (getdata) {
                console.log(getdata)
                //console.log(getdata[0])
            }
          
        })
    };
    </script>
</head>
<body>
    <div> 
       <button onclick="GetSuppliers()">获取数组数据</button>
    </div>
</body>
</html>

用到的知识点:

数组转成json格式:

string json_data = JsonConvert.SerializeObject(selectList); 

不当之处请斧正! 

相关文章:

  • 描述@keyframes规则在 CSS 动画中的原理及作用,如何创建一个简单的动画
  • 大厂技术博客总结
  • MySQL 5.7升级8.0报异常:ONLY_FULL_GROUP_BY
  • 猿大师中间件:如何在最新Chrome浏览器Web网页内嵌本地OCX控件?
  • Docker学习笔记(十二)docker镜像没有vi怎么优雅的编辑文本
  • FAQ - VMware vSphere Web 控制台中鼠标控制不了怎么办?
  • Cursor学习总结
  • 正则表达式基本语法和Java中的简单使用
  • LiteIDE中配置golang编译生成无CMD窗口EXE的步骤
  • Mybatis——04
  • 【Python】基于OpenAI API实现PDF发票信息提取
  • Linux 基础入门操作 第十一章 图形界面设计
  • 【day2】数据结构刷题 栈
  • 【linux】线程概念与控制
  • 05STM32定时器-01定时器概述
  • C#测试基于OllamaSharp调用本地DeepSeek模型
  • AI基础01-文本数据采集
  • TCP/IP协议的三次握手和四次挥手
  • python爬虫Redis数据库
  • Win32桌面编程:ACLUI.DLL,EditSecurity(IntPtr hwndOwner, ISecurityInformation psi)
  • 旅行网站系统/聚合搜索引擎接口
  • 网站建设的基本步骤是哪些/福建seo学校
  • 黑龙江专业建站/关键词优化流程
  • gps建站步骤视频/快速网站排名提升
  • 请问聊城网站建设/浙江短视频seo优化网站
  • 若比邻跨境电商网站/营销策划主要做些什么